Single storey educational facility, 47,000 square foot total area, for grades primary to grade 6, replacing the St. Anthony Daniel School in Sydney, NS. The building structure/exterior facade is load-bearing tilt-up concrete panels. Location: Sydney, Nova Scotia Delivery Method: Design, Build, Contractor Value: $5.9 million Completed: September 2003
A 226 bed residence constructed on a hotel-style model including individual bathrooms, air conditioning and modern furnishing and full community kitchens. Construction consisted of load bearing block and hollow core concrete slabs. Location: Antigonish, Nova Scotia Delivery Method: Design, Build, Contractor Value: $16.5 million Completed: July 2006
